Output 8b9116c8d56539914dadb27377657ee8fe4677d774b5ff8a1e9f270dabe05711:1

value
81780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03c31f45769371f4296ec4cf1277b3ad4a6a2bd3 OP_EQUALVERIFY OP_CHECKSIG
address
1LtmuDxhtLKfTFUukE7GqqL4yx8kaN7oC
transaction
8b9116c8d56539914dadb27377657ee8fe4677d774b5ff8a1e9f270dabe05711
confirmations
137354
spent
true